ST09 SMS is a 2011 Porsche Boxster in Black with a 3,387c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 92.9%.

Across all 2011 Porsche Boxster models, the average MOT pass rate is 91.3% with a typical mileage of 35,586 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Porsche Boxster f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 19,504 recorded failures. If you're considering buying ST09 SMS,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Porsche Boxster typ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 15 years old, this Porsche Boxster is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
